
Lately, there's been a huge jump in the global demand for high-capacity Lithium Batteries. As more players jump into the scene, it's no surprise to see a whole bunch of suppliers popping up, all trying to catch the eye of international buyers. Experts are saying the lithium-ion battery market could hit around $100 billion by 2025 — basically fueled by the booming electric vehicle scene and the push for renewable energy tech. Chinese suppliers are really making a mark here, offering top-notch batteries at pretty competitive prices.
When you look at the big names like CATL and BYD, you see they’re leading the charge not just in production but also in innovation—improving energy density and speeding up charging times are game-changers for users. Still, making the right choice isn’t exactly a walk in the park. Not every manufacturer out there checks all the safety and quality boxes needed for international standards. So, buyers really need to do their homework and dig deep to avoid any headaches down the line.
Even with all this growth, there are definitely some hurdles. Supply chain hiccups and shortages of raw materials can throw a wrench in production schedules. And in such a high-stakes market, quality assurance isn’t something to take lightly. Picking the right supplier takes some careful consideration if you want reliable and sustainable sources for high-capacity lithium batteries — it’s all about doing your homework and being extra cautious.

High capacity lithium batteries are crucial for various applications, including electric vehicles and renewable energy storage. They offer higher energy density, which translates to extended usage times and improved performance. According to industry reports, the global lithium-ion battery market is expected to reach USD 100 billion by 2025, highlighting increasing demand.
Key features of these batteries include enhanced cycling stability, faster charging times, and a longer lifespan. Data shows that high-capacity options can retain about 80% of their charge after 500 cycles. However, some manufacturers face challenges in balancing capacity with safety. This trade-off can affect reliability and user confidence.
Moreover, a significant concern is the environmental impact. Battery production can lead to considerable waste and emissions. The industry is now moving towards more sustainable manufacturing processes. Leveraging recycled materials is one step in the right direction. Nevertheless, ongoing research is needed to fully address these environmental challenges. The journey to perfecting high capacity lithium batteries is still a work in progress.

When selecting lithium battery suppliers, buyers should prioritize certain criteria. Quality assurance is paramount. According to a report from the International Energy Agency, the lithium-ion battery market is projected to reach $100 billion by 2025. This growth can lead to variable quality among suppliers. Buyers must look for manufacturers with certifications, such as ISO 9001, to ensure product reliability. High Capacity 18650 cells are essential for many applications, requiring suppliers that specialize in this technology.
Next, consider the supplier's experience and expertise. Established suppliers often have advanced manufacturing processes and robust R&D capabilities. A study by BloombergNEF indicates that new entrants may struggle to match the performance of established players. It's vital to assess the supplier's history in the market and their ability to innovate. Communication is another critical aspect. Suppliers that offer transparent and responsive customer service can help resolve issues quickly.
Lastly, price should not be the sole determining factor. While competitive pricing can attract buyers, low costs might indicate compromised quality. Balancing cost against reliability and performance is essential. Engaging in thorough due diligence and supplier audits can mitigate risks. This approach helps buyers find suppliers that not only meet their capacity needs but also ensure long-term partnerships.

The efficiency of golf carts can significantly be enhanced by integrating 6.4V 220AH deep cycle batteries, which are becoming increasingly popular for their performance and longevity. Industry reports indicate that deep cycle batteries are designed to handle repeated discharge and recharge cycles, making them ideal for the operational demands of golf carts. According to a recent study by the Battery Council International, deep cycle batteries can achieve over 1,500 charge-discharge cycles when properly maintained, substantially outpacing standard lead-acid batteries, which typically last around 300-500 cycles.
Moreover, deep cycle batteries, particularly the 6.4V 220AH variants, offer an impressive power capacity that allows golf carts to operate longer on a single charge. Insights from industry performance analyses suggest that these batteries deliver consistent power output and can efficiently store and release energy when needed, providing a seamless golfing experience. Reports highlight that the weight-to-power ratio of deep cycle batteries enables better handling and increased range, making them indispensable for both recreational and operational golf carts.
Finally, longevity is a critical factor that impacts the total cost of ownership for golf carts. Research indicates that users can expect a lifespan of up to 10 years with proper care, significantly reducing the need for frequent replacements. This durability is a crucial aspect that golf cart owners should consider to enhance performance, reduce downtime, and ultimately optimize their golfing experience. With the right choice of battery, operators can ensure their carts remain efficient and reliable on the course.
